Deutschland - On May 23, 2025, DM-Drogerie Markt GmbH announced a callback for the "DMBIO Beeren Crunchy" product. Only the packs with the best -before date of December 11, 2025 are affected.

Customers are expressly asked not to consume the affected product and bring it back to the nearest DM branch. This also applies to packs that have already been opened. The purchase price is fully reimbursed, and this is done without presenting a receipt. For people without allergies or intolerances, there is usually no health risk when eating the product.

special caution in allergy sufferers

lupins are a potential health risk for people with an allergy to these legumes. This appeals to the recall particularly consumers who are sensitive to lupins. DM-Drogerie Markt GmbH emphasizes the high priority of product quality and apologizes for the inconvenience.

The product "DMBio Beeren Crunchy" was sold throughout Germany in the DM branches. For more information, customers can contact the DM service center, by phone at 0800 365 8633 or by email to service center@dm.de.

General context for product recalls

recalls like this are not unusual in the food industry and often serve health protection. According to information from Consumer center are obliged to recall products if they do not meet the food safety requirements. Frequent reasons for recruitment are contaminants from bacteria, inadmissible ingredients or incorrect labels.

consumers are also well advised to inform themselves about current warnings. The central point of contact for product warnings in Germany, foodwarung.de enables users to get over the current via Push-, e-mail or RSS To keep warning messages up to date.
